Knights of Columbus Asset Advisors LLC Raises Stock Position in SPX Technologies, Inc. (NYSE:SPXC)

Knights of Columbus Asset Advisors LLC raised its stake in shares of SPX Technologies, Inc. (NYSE:SPXCFree Report) by 240.3% during the fourth quarter, according to the company in its most recent 13F filing with the Securities and Exchange Commission. The firm owned 59,531 shares of the company’s stock after purchasing an additional 42,039 shares during the quarter. Knights of Columbus Asset Advisors LLC owned approximately 0.13% of SPX Technologies worth $6,013,000 at the end of the most recent reporting period.

SPX Technologies Stock Performance

SPX Technologies stock traded down $0.25 during midday trading on Friday, hitting $117.42. The stock had a trading volume of 58,710 shares, compared to its average volume of 230,412. The firm’s fifty day moving average is $116.29 and its two-hundred day moving average is $99.89. The company has a market capitalization of $5.43 billion, a PE ratio of 61.42, a P/E/G ratio of 1.30 and a beta of 1.25. SPX Technologies, Inc. has a 52-week low of $61.09 and a 52-week high of $124.81. The company has a current ratio of 1.77, a quick ratio of 1.08 and a debt-to-equity ratio of 0.44.

SPX Technologies (NYSE:SPXCGet Free Report) last released its earnings results on Thursday, February 22nd. The company reported $1.25 earnings per share (EPS) for the quarter, hitting the consensus estimate of $1.25. The company had revenue of $469.40 million during the quarter, compared to analyst estimates of $481.98 million. SPX Technologies had a net margin of 5.16% and a return on equity of 17.30%. The firm’s quarterly revenue was up 9.3% compared to the same quarter last year. During the same period in the prior year, the firm posted $1.17 EPS. On average, research analysts forecast that SPX Technologies, Inc. will post 5.03 EPS for the current year.

SPX Technologies Profile

(Free Report)

SPX Technologies, Inc supplies infrastructure equipment serving the heating, ventilation, and cooling (HVAC); and detection and measurement markets worldwide. The company operates in two segments, HVAC and Detection and Measurement. The HVAC segment engineers, designs, manufactures, installs, and services package and process cooling products and engineered air movement solutions for the HVAC industrial and power generation markets, as well as boilers, heating, and ventilation products for the residential and commercial markets.
